Jubilant HollisterStier LLC, Spokane's Largest Manufacturing Company, and well-established member of the business community, provides a complete range of services to support the pharmaceutical and biopharmaceutical industries. Jubilant HollisterStier is a nationally recognized contract manufacturer of sterile injectable vials, and lyophilized products. The Allergy business is a worldwide leader in the manufacture of allergenic extracts, targeted primarily at treating allergies and asthma. Jubilant HollisterStier is a proud member of the Jubilant Pharma family.

Job Description:
The QA Compliance lead Associate provides support to the company Deviations, Corrective and Preventive Action (CAPA) program through a complete assessment of Root Cause Analysis (RCA) of deviations and vendor complaints/issues. Assure product compliance and product safety. Ensure accurate and timely data entry and oversight of the company Quality Systems related to Deviations, CAPA and vendor complaint activities.
- Review deviations, investigations and CAPAs to ensure accuracy, consistency and compliance with applicable SOPs/Policies, Specifications and related guidelines/regulations.
- Accountable for facilitating deviations investigation/resolution, assessing product impact and for completing/writing final assessment/lot disposition for QA Management and Client review and approval.
- Enters data into database in support of the corporate RCA and CAPA activities.
- Provide oversight of investigational RCA group activities including preparation of meeting agenda, providing necessary information to meeting participants, publishing of meeting minutes, and follow-up on agreed upon activities and tasks.
- Interface with management and responsible individuals to assure task completion on or before established due dates.
- 6.Responsible for supporting quality systems, processes and procedures (e.g. Deviations, CAPA, Vendor complaint, etc...) to assure compliance and product quality and safety.
- Accountable for assisting the QA and applicable Department Management to ensure and follow up on implementation of corrective actions that stem from deviations, audit or regulatory inspections.
- Provide deviations and CAPA metrics as needed in support of management review of system data.
- Work extensively with appropriate department(s) to gain an understanding of the production/analytical testing process and other applicable process to ensure capture of appropriate details and conclusions in the investigation or corrective action documents.
- Provide investigation training as needed to the Quality Unit and other departments to ensure that investigations are handled consistently throughout the company.
- Speak to deviations during regulatory and client audits.
- Assist with reviews and approval of minor deviations in the QMS system.
- Assist with extension requests approvals when permitted by procedure.
- Assist with RCA chart review for the QAC team members.
- Act as QA SME on Change Control records within the QMS.
- Provide leadership and guidance to QAC team members.
- Report performance issues to QAC supervisor as they arise.
- Act as the QA Compliance Supervisor when requested by the QA Manager. (In the absence of the supervisor)
